Resumen

CAMPOS MARTINEZ, Lina Aurora; GUERRA SALCEDO, Marisela de la Caridad  y  RIFA TELLEZ, Julio César. Seeking and self-management of microbiological knowledge in the Bachelor of Biology Education. trf [online]. 2024, vol.20, n.1, pp. 162-180.  Epub 01-Ene-2024. ISSN 2077-2955.

Objective:

This article aims at describing a systemic understanding that represents the logic of the process of educating information seeking and processing competencies in biology teacher trainees.

Methods:

Modeling makes possible to devise a model for competency-based education related to individual seeking and processing of microbiology information. The systemic-structural-functional method was used to achieve a comprehensive understanding of the researched object; that is to describe its structure, functions and hierarchical relationships of the constituent elements. Theoretical level methods such as: analytical-synthetic and inductive-deductive were also used.

Result:

The contribution is linked to the process of educating information seeking and processing competencies for microbiology self-management. This may be accomplished by relating the processes of apprehending microbiological knowledge, mobilizing self-management information procedures and contextualizing competency-based education.

Conclusion:

The resulting systemic conception that represents the logic of personal management of microbiological knowledge may favor comprehensiveness in the performance of personal management of microbiological knowledge in correspondence with the dynamics of the problems of the profession in students of the Bachelor's Degree in Biology Education.
